Some AI agents are stepping into a new role: handling their own finances, from earning revenue to managing budgets. Unlike traditional software, these agents can charge for services, control allocated funds, and negotiate costs, all while staying mindful of their operational expenses. This financial autonomy allows them to operate like mini-businesses, making decisions that balance service quality with sustainability.
